Analysis

In 2021, primary government expenditures as a proportion of original approved in Micronesia, Federated States of stood at 111.5%. That is the highest value across all 15 years on record.

The figure is up 5.2% on the previous year and up 44.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, primary government expenditures as a proportion of original approved in Micronesia, Federated States of peaked at 111.5%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 69.8%, in 2015.

Micronesia, Federated States of ranks 21st of 165 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 15 years of available data.

Primary government expenditures as a proportion of original approved budget measures the extent to which aggregate budget expenditure outturn reflects the amount originally approved, as defined in government budget documentation and fiscal reports. The coverage is budgetary central government (BCG) and the time period covered is the last three completed fiscal years.
